Francisco Cerundolo achieved his 150th tour-level win at the BCI Seguros Chile Open in Santiago, defeating Emilio Nava in a dominant performance. Meanwhile, Sebastian Baez also advanced to the semi-finals, setting the stage for exciting matches.

Key Insights

Francisco Cerundolo secured his 150th tour-level win, becoming the first active Argentine to reach this milestone.

Cerundolo defeated Emilio Nava 6-1, 6-1 in just 66 minutes, demonstrating strong form on South American clay.

Sebastian Baez ousted Alejandro Tabilo, continuing his strong performance at the Chile Open, where he aims to secure his second title.

Yannick Hanfmann reached the semi-finals, marking the first time a German player has advanced to this stage on clay in South America since 2014.

Francisco Cerundolo's dominant performance against Emilio Nava underscores his confidence and skill on clay courts. Cerundolo leads Hanfmann 4-1 in their head-to-head series, setting the stage for a potentially exciting semi-final clash. Sebastian Baez, with a strong tournament record in Santiago, is aiming to become the first player to claim two titles at the ATP 250 event there. Luciano Darderi also advanced, defeating Andrea Pellegrino, and will face Baez in the semi-finals.
